We seek to rediscover the art of the piano as the composer heard it on the instruments of the time;  to collect and study the instruments themselves, conserving many for history, and performing on many, so we might rediscover history’s magic.  We exhibit and curate instruments, tell the great stories of piano and society, and study the history of the piano, its technology and its builders.

Historical Steinway Exhibit added to full tour Beginning August 6

 

Steinway 7’2’ loaned to the exhibit by Bob and Marcia Davis, one of the earliest overstrung Steinway parlor grands

New Exhibit: the Steinway Parlor Grand 1859-1892

 

Th Steinweg Nachf 1644 website pic

Above:  Th. Steinweg Nachfolger Grand

 

 Tour of New Exhibit is hosted by

 

Period Piano Collection

 

The new exhibit highlights successive Steinway “parlor grands” in every design gestation from their earliest to their last iteration
